[Seasar-user:11899] Re: [S2Dao]DaoCreatorとAbstractDaoについて

Toshihiro Nakamura [E-MAIL ADDRESS DELETED]
2007年 12月 4日 (火) 21:49:58 JST


中村(taedium)です。

> DaoCreator を使用してコンポーネントの自動登録を行っているの
> ですが、AbstractDao を extends したDaoのメソッドを呼び出し
> ても自作した実体のメソッドが動かないのですが、AbstractDaoを
> extends したDaoの場合、diconに何か設定が必要なのでしょうか?

SMART deployを利用しているということですね。

TestAbstractDaoImplではなくTestAbstractDaoが
コンポーネントとして登録されてしまっていませんか?

# TestAbstractDaoImplとTestAbstractDaoのどちらが
# 登録されたかはログに出力されていると思います。

TestAbstractDaolが登録されてしまっている場合は、
TestAbstractDaoImplのパッケージ名を確認してみてください。

パッケージ名は

  ルートパッケージ.dao.impl

でなければいけません。

AbstractDaoを使うためのdiconの設定等は特にありません。
-- 
Toshihiro Nakamura



Seasar-user メーリングリストの案内